RS-485 communication is a widely used serial interface standard designed for robust, long-distance, and noise-resistant data transmission. Known for its differential signaling and multi-point support, RS-485 excels in industrial automation, building control, smart energy systems, and other environments where reliable data exchange is a must.
This reference design establishes a simulation model for implementing RS-485 communication over power cabling. Use this simulation model to assess the feasibility of implementing RS-485 communication at a given data rate, cable length, and loading for a specific cable before taking the time-consuming step of building a representative network.
In addition to strong anti-interference, the RS-485 protocol also has the following key advantages that make it stand out in many scenarios: Unlike RS-232, which can only communicate point-to-point, RS-485 supports multiple devices on a bus (up to 32 standard loads, which can be expanded to more through repeaters).
For troubleshooting or fine-tuning, tools such as oscilloscopes, logic analyzers, or RS-485 protocol analyzers can be used to inspect the signal waveform. RS-485 is widely adopted as a physical layer for numerous communication protocols that define how devices address, transmit, and validate data.
